Q4) Divide as directed.
(i) 5(2x + 1) (3x + 5) ÷ (2x + 1)
(ii) 26xy(x + 5)(y – 4) ÷ 13x(y – 4)
(iii) 52pqr (p + q) (q + r) (r + p) ÷ 104pq(q + r) (r + p)
(iv) 20\left(y+4\right)\left(y^2+5y+3\right)\div5\left(y+4\right)
(v) x(x + 1) (x + 2) (x + 3) ÷ x(x + 1)
Solution 4:
(i) \frac{5\left(2x+1\right)\left(3x+5\right)}{2x+1}
= 5(3x+5)
(ii) \frac{2\times13\times x\times y\times\left(x+5\right)\times\left(y-4\right)}{13\times x\times\left(y-4\right)}
=2\times y\times\left(x+5\right)
=2y\left(x+5\right)
(iii) \frac{2\times2\times13\times p\times q\times r\times\left(p+q\right)\times\left(q+r\right)\times\left(r+p\right)}{2\times2\times2\times13\times p\times q\times\left(q+p\right)\times\left(r+p\right)}
=\frac{r\left(p+q\right)}{2}
(iv) \frac{20\left(y+4\right)\left(y^2+5y+3\right)}{5\left(y+4\right)}
=4\left(y^2+5y+3\right)
(v)\frac{x\left(x+1\right)\left(x+2\right)\left(x+3\right)}{x\left(x+1\right)}
(x+2)(x+3)
